How about fixing some JKnobMan bugs in the mean time?
* "Individual" export option doesn't work correctly with oversampling set to 2x or 4x.
* File names of "Individual" exported frames is not as it's stated in the help (which suggests filenames like image-0001.bmp, image-0002.bmp etc., but that doesn't happen, in reality, the names are image.bmp, image1.bmp, image2.bmp... the first frame doesn't get a number!) Ideally we should be able to decide how we want to name the exported frames (and also when importing them to the Image primitive as "multiframe").

Hi, it's been awhile.
I would like to make time to fix the oversampling export issue.
About file name issue, the help document is insufficient.
filenames are generated keeping specified suffix numbering format like:
image0.png => image0.png, image1.png, image2.png....
image0001.png => image0001.png, image0002.png, image0003.png...
and you can start from any number:
image12.png => image12.png, image13.png, image14.png...
in all case, the first file is that exactly you specified (this is next best thing for overwrite prompting).
then automatically suffix number from 1 is added if the specified filename has no suffix number.
